Publisher's Synopsis

Networking has a variety of meanings, but is essentially about building relationships in order to exchange information and provide mutual support to aid decision-making, and create lasting customers, partners and alliances.;This text examines the dynamics of the environment in which networking plays a crucial role, and discusses the different types of network available, together with case studies and interviews with networking personalities. The book also reviews the changing professional and corporate environment of the UK, Europe, USA and the global environment.
